Annelation of Aromatic Compounds via 1-Aminoisobenzofurans
Abstract
dc:descriptionThe annelation of aromatic amides via 1-aminoisobenzofurans as transient reaction intermediates are reported. Three different methodologies are developed for generation of the aminoisobenzofurans in the presence of dienophiles. These involve: (1) the decomposition of an N,N-diisopropyl-o-((alpha)-diazomethyl) aromatic amide in the presence of a catalyst, (2) cesium fluoride induced (alpha)-elimination of an N,N-diisopropyl-o-((alpha),(alpha)'-bromotrimethylsilylmethyl)benzamide and (3) 2,2',6,6'-tetramethyl-piperidine induced 1,4-elimination of the cyclic imidate salt. In all cases, precursors can be synthesized by o-lithiation methodology.
